Ca2+-Activated Potassium Channel Modulators
There are 8 members of the KCa channel family, all of which are homo or heterotetramers of α-subunits, with either 6 or 7 transmembrane domains. Some family members also have associated regulatory subunits. KCa1.1 (BK), KCa2.x (SK) and KCa3.1 (IK) ion channels open in response to intracellular Ca2+ levels.
